Output 1caac91b587fc8f7b2da653335d12f79094312062066d8b19c681fff1b0d7e29:1

value
1446507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e99e9eea287a666f2e41110682ce21419a70c5 OP_EQUAL
address
37hXiBra5dUwyfCWqNQFpZxYjBXpfVSHaX
transaction
1caac91b587fc8f7b2da653335d12f79094312062066d8b19c681fff1b0d7e29
confirmations
412309
spent
true